Eat More Chocolate

It's true! Dark chocolate is the new health food. Recent studies have shown that a daily serving of dark chocolate may:


1. Lower blood pressure
2. Reduce the risk of diabetes
3. Keep cholesterol levels stable or even improve them
4. Enhance cognitive function by increasing blood flow to the brain
5. Boosts mood
6. Prevents cell damage
7. Improves blood sugar levels
8. Eases a persistant cough
9. Helps ease chronic fatigue syndrome
10. Raises HDL cholesterol and lowers LDL cholesterol

Dark chocolate is full of antioxidants that help fight off cell damaging molecules in the body that accelerate aging and disease. The higher the percentage of cocoa in the chocolate, the more antioxidants it has and the better for you it is.

Health benefits are only with dark chocolate. White chocolate doesn't contain any antioxidants and milk chocolate contains extra ingredients that won't let the body absorb the antioxidants
